Location Set at the foot of the Magaliesberg mountain range in North West Province, Rustenburg lies on a major highway (N4) about 140 km by road from Johannesburg and 130 km from Pretoria. Being in close proximity to Phokeng, the capital of the Royal Bafokeng Nation, where the Royal Bafokeng Stadium is located made it a perfect choice for one of the official host cities of the 2010 FIFA World Cup. History Rustenburg, meaning “place of rest”, this pretty little town’s streets are lined with the ubiquitous jacaranda tree.
